The average train weighs between 3,000 to 18,000 tons or more based on the number of cars attached, the cargo it’s holding, and several other variable factors. Given the sheer size of standard trains, and the average mph of a train in the U.S. ( between 66-150 mph), often, railroad accidents are fatal, or, at the very least, result in severe injuries.

IL’ Statute of Limitations for railroad accident claims in Godfrey is within two years from the date that an accident occurs, but must include detailed evidence of the victim’s harm and losses and evidence of the train operator or employee’s fault in causing or contributing to the victim’s harm and losses.
Most railroad accident lawsuits in IL supported by the above evidence can recover compensation for medical bills, mental and emotional distress, loss of income, personal property damage, and other damages related to a rail-crossing collision or another railroad accident in IL. However, not all railroad lawsuits are eligible to recover damages.
